The present age of a mother is 3 times that of her daughter. After 10 years, the mother's age will be twice the daughter's age. Find their present ages.

Let daughter=x ⇒ mother=3x; 3x+10=2(x+10) ⇒ x=14.
Final Answer: Option C — 42, 14
